Make sure your shooting base is solid, not moving at all. If your good on that, try taping your scope at its adjustment screws. I simply use the empty shell, and tap the adjusters a couple times. It seats the lenses. Then try couple more shots. If your sure on all that, then most def. try some other ammo. I've had rifles that just wouldn't shoot a certain ammo well, while others with the same exact gun have no problems with that same ammo.
